At first glance, the clarinet and cello make an unusual pair — there’s quite a contrast in how composers write for the instruments. Yet as this duo program progresses, Matthew Boyles, clarinet and James Jaffe, cello unveil how both instruments share a vocal sound and a true sense of fun.

We’ll begin with solo works by Igor Stravinsky and Benjamin Britten, then continue with stunning keyboard transcriptions of Frederic Chopin and J.S. Bach. The end of the program is lighthearted and rhythmic: duos by Morton Gould (for his friend Benny Goodman) and Swedish cello star Svante Henryson.
